Or. Admin. Code § 291-157-0010 - Definitions
(1) Inmate: Any
person under the supervision of the Department of Corrections who is not on
parole, post-prison supervision or probation status.
(2) Release Subsidy: Financial assistance
allocated to a releasee by the county for the purpose of purchasing essential
goods or services related to release needs.
(3) Release Counselor: A person employed by
the Department of Corrections charged with release planning for
inmates.
(4) Incidental Funds:
Funds not to exceed $25 allocated to a releasee by the Department of
Corrections for immediate financial assistance upon release.
(4) Releasee: Any inmate that is being
released to or has been released to the community on parole, post-prison
supervision, or discharge status.
(5) Trust Account Funds: Those monies
deposited to an inmate's trust account which may be used by the inmate to
purchase authorized items or services during his/her incarceration or be
assessed by the functional unit to pay any indebtedness incurred while under
supervision of the Department of Corrections.
